what is carriage return in javascript

Flake it till you make it: how to detect and deal with flaky tests (Ep. First lets see what their characters are, Carriage Return (CR): Also know as Cartridge return, It is a control character used to reset the position of the cursor to the beginning of the next line of a text file. By clicking Accept All, you consent to the use of ALL the cookies. How to Replace a Character with Carriage Return in Javascript, How to Replace Comma with Carriage Return in Javascript, How to Replace a Character in a String with Another Character in Javascript, How to Replace a Character with Nothing in Javascript, How to Replace a Character with New Line in Javascript, How to Replace a Character with Space in Javascript, How to Insert Dash After Every Character in Input in Javascript, How to Insert Dash After Every 2nd Character in Input in Javascript, How to Insert Dash After Every 3rd character in Input in Javascript, How to Add Space After Every 4th Character in Input in Javascript, How to Insert Space After Every 4th Character in Input in Javascript, We have done some basic styling using CSS and added the link to our, We have also included our javascript file, We are displaying the original string in the. 1. We can return primitive values (such as Boolean . How to find a carriage return in JavaScript? The character that we are going to replace, would be an exclamation mark (!). By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Toggle some bits and get an actual square. This page is used to test the proper operation of your recent MOJO Marketplace installation of WordPress! In the above code, the value is assigned to a variable "r" using the assignment operator. A carriage return means moving the cursor to the beginning of the line. @AKTed: That question and answer is about the HTTP protocol. Carriage Return. Do you know you can change the line delimiter to CR only in notepad++? What is the carriage return character in JavaScript? To subscribe to this RSS feed, copy and paste this URL into your RSS reader. Specifying the data-url attribute along with the data-remote one will trigger an Ajax call to the given URL. I have tried both with vbScript and Python, and when I verify it looks correct, but when I apply it to the map it is all on a single line. typewriters, teletypes, and fax machines. Collection of Helpful Guides & Tutorials! 528), Microsoft Azure joins Collectives on Stack Overflow. What actually happens when you hit enter is two characters occur [on Windows]. How can I remove a specific item from an array? The raw content of a string includes the carriage returns, i.e. Note: The line feed, represented by n and a carriage return r are very different. Can a remote machine execute a Linux command? There are two codes that are involved in denoting new lines of text, known as "Carriage Return" "\r" and "Line Feed" "\n" collectively known as CRLF. Can state or city police officers enforce the FCC regulations? Carriage Return \t: Horizontal Tabulator \v: Vertical Tabulator: . How do I remove a property from a JavaScript object? Can you suggest me how to remove the New Line Character,Carriage Return and Tab Characters from a string? In the following example, we have some global variables. This is a powerful technique that we call Ajax. How to get raw content from string including carriage return? A carriage return was a lever on the left-hand side of typewriters that moved the paper up. 06-12-2014 03:55 PM. In the context of an alert box and most other scenarios where you just want to create a new line, all you need is \n ("newline"). Often abbreviated CR, a carriage return is a special code that moves the cursor (or print head) to the beginning of the current line. How to check whether a string contains a substring in JavaScript? For example, the following function returns the square of its argument, x , where x is a number. The only change made is the value of the argument "replaceWith" when passed from the textarea. For best readability, programmers often like to avoid code lines longer than rev2023.1.17.43168. 2 Why is the carriage return in a typewriter called carriage? What did it sound like when you played the cassette tape with programs on it? When editing JS files, I suggest that you save in CR-LF (carriage return-line feed) format so that Windows users can quickly open the file up in Notepad. A carriage return is a character that is used to start a new paragraph in HTML and XML. ), How to see the number of layers currently selected in QGIS, Card trick: guessing the suit if you see the remaining three cards (important is that you can't move or turn the cards). Shop jnichols925's closet or find the perfect look from millions of stylists. But opting out of some of these cookies may affect your browsing experience. For example, Macintosh uses the code CR to indicate the end of each line, similar to the typewriter. The carriage return, also known as the enter key, was once called a lever. Would Marx consider salary workers to be members of the proleteriat? Probably Notepad++ added an LF by itself. The \n character matches newline characters. 1. The carriage return character (decimal character 10 in ASCII or r in C, C++, C#, Java etc.) How does the match ( ) method in regexp work? What actually happens when you hit enter is two characters occur [on Windows]. To learn more, see our tips on writing great answers. Difference Between a Horizontal and a Vertical Carriage Return. Since VS Code release 1.3, the regex find has supported newline characters. Note: If the regular expression does not include the g modifier (to perform a global search), the match () method will return only the first match in the string. The cookies is used to store the user consent for the cookies in the category "Necessary". after A2, B2, and C2). But for the sake of simplicity, we will make use of template string which helps in creating a dynamic string by using variables in it. Not the answer you're looking for? How could one outsmart a tracking implant? Can I change which outlet on a circuit has the GFCI reset switch? How to Create and Run It. Its just another form of line break that (admittedly) isnt used that much anymore. Carriage Return is adding a new line within the cell Line Within The Cell To insert a new line in excel cell, a user can adopt any of the following three methods: Manually inserting a new line or using a shortcut key, Applying CHAR excel function, Using name manager with CHAR(10) function. Why not bookmark it and come back again later. This website uses cookies to improve your experience while you navigate through the website. Java provides a universal capability to get the current platform line separator: System.lineSeparator () Also, you can use "%n" as a new line separator within printf method provided by . read more. The cookie is used to store the user consent for the cookies in the category "Other. Note: If the regular expression does not include the g modifier (to perform a global search),. The function will stop executing when the return statement is called. While there is a Find and Replace option in the Edit menu there is no means of entering a Return as the replaced item. We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. <CR> or return, is a control character or mechanism used in order to reset a position of the device to the beginning of a line of text. The return statement is used to return a particular value from the function to the function caller. Fast shipping and buyer protection. Also you can use \n to mark carriage return in quoted strings.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ors. A new line is generally used in the content to improve its readability. If we want to check if the Enter key is pressed, we can use the \r . The code is \n . It is passed as an empty string rather than a break tag. The hard-pressing of this key only happens now when ending paragraphs but not for starting them anymore . Carriage return is a command that causes the printer to be positioned, or the cursor to be displayed, at the left margin. This is commonly escaped as r, abbreviated CR, and has ASCII value 13 or 0x0D. \r does 2 kinds of work. This cookie is set by GDPR Cookie Consent plugin. A line feed means moving one line forward. What does \r do in JavaScript? There are numerous ways to replace a character with carriage return. This method returns null if no match is found. This article will discuss what carriage returns are and how theyre used. It is well known that RTF code '\line' can be used to create a new line in ODS RTF or ODS TAGSETS.RTF destination. Short for carriage return, CR is often used to represent a carriage return done by pressing the Enter and Return key. When was the term directory replaced by folder? Generally, both of them are used together (rn). You can also specify extra parameters through the data-params attribute. How to handle Base64 and binary file content types? 80 characters. Comparing two JavaScript objects always returns false. What actually happens when you hit enter is two characters occur [on Windows]. The most popular variant of its name is a laconic abbreviation CR. refers to the returning of the cursor to the beginning of the line. \r\n is a Windows Style. 1 What is the carriage return character in JavaScript? Windows: Carry return \r\n followed by a character on the newline. These cookies will be stored in your browser only with your consent. The match() method searches a string for a match against a regular expression, and returns the matches, as an Array object. The carriage return character (decimal character 10 in ASCII or r in C, C++, C#, Java etc.) Combining these two powers, a JavaScript writer can make a web page that can update just parts of itself, without needing to get the full page data from the server. The name comes from a printers carriage, as monitors were rare when the name was coined. How to automatically classify a sentence or text based on its context? Solution 1. Usually, carriage returns often go like this and you can use more than one to go down multiple lines. Sep 12, 2018. What is Computer Science? CR = Carriage Return ( \r, 0x0D in hexadecimal, 13 in decimal) moves the cursor to the beginning of the line without advancing to the next line. What are the "zebeedees" (in Pern series)? A carriage return (\r) moves cursor to the beginning of current line and newline character (\n) moves cursor to the next line. It used at the end of a sentence to express a very strong feeling. What is the alt code for carriage return? The below example represents how the raw content can be obtained using this method: How can I make Twitter, Facebook and Reddit share buttons load last? LF = Line Feed ( \n, 0x0A in hexadecimal, 10 in decimal) moves the cursor down to the . If you want to report an error, or if you want to make a suggestion, do not hesitate to send us an e-mail: let carName1 = "Volvo XC60"; The cookies is used to store the user consent for the cookies in the category "Necessary". Indefinite article before noun starting with "the". What is Windows.Old Folder And How to Delete It? Upon click of a button, we will add a carriage return in the string and display the result on the screen. Can state or city police officers enforce the FCC regulations? Did Richard Feynman say that anyone who claims to understand quantum physics is lying or crazy? If a JavaScript statement does not fit on one line, the best place to break refers to the returning of the "cursor" to the beginning of the line. // Double quotes. If a JavaScript statement does not fit on one line, the best place to break it is after an operator: Example. This cookie is set by GDPR Cookie Consent plugin. Unlock Productivity With These 15 Must-Have Chrome Extensions, 14 Interesting Facts about Python Programming Language, 14 Facts About PHP Every Web Developer Should Know. Use \t to match a tab character (ASCII 0x09), \r for carriage return (0x0D) and \n for line feed (0x0A). surrounding the string: To find the length of a string, use the built-in length property: Because strings must be written within quotes, JavaScript will misunderstand this string: The string will be chopped to "We are the so-called ". Since 1995, more than 100 tech experts and researchers have kept Webopedia's definitions, articles, and study guides up to date.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. Using HTML5 EME (Encrypted Media Extensions) for JS, How do I use the ga() function in Google Analytics when the tag is in Google Tag Manager: Uncaught ReferenceError: ga is not defined. Rails automatically detects and compensates for this. How to insert a (Carriage Return) in a Javascript String? The name comes from a printer's carriage, as monitors were rare when the name was coined. It eventually evolved into an automatic power return, which is now pressed with your pinky finger to move it back and start over again. Thanks for contributing an answer to Webmasters Stack Exchange! Answer (1 of 17): Welcome to the traditional horror of text file line endings (and be grateful that you're not asked to handle tabs). To subscribe to this RSS feed, copy and paste this URL into your RSS reader. CR and LF are control characters or bytecode that can be used to mark a line break in a text file. CRLF is the acronym used to refer to Carriage Return (r) Line Feed (n). Enter is the same as carriage return, but it can also be used to denote tab stops or new lines in programming languages like Visual Basic, Python etc. Making statements based on opinion; back them up with references or personal experience. Using only carriage return in Python. How to remove carriage return, new line characters? CR and LF are control characters or bytecode that can be used to mark a line break in a text file. For more detailed information, see our Function Section on Function Definitions , Parameters , Invocation and . What does carriage return do on a notepad? Connect and share knowledge within a single location that is structured and easy to search. Version 1.7 Version 1.5 Version 1.4 Version 1.3 Version 1.2 Version 1.1 Version 1.0. Who are we? "; let text = "We are the so-called \"Vikings\" from the north. These cookies ensure basic functionalities and security features of the website, anonymously. What are possible explanations for why blue states appear to have higher homeless rates per capita than red states? To use this feature set the find window to regex mode and use \n as the newline character.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features. A Computer Science portal for geeks. In the ASCII character set, a carriage return has a decimal value of 13. QGIS: Aligning elements in the second column in the legend.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. Related Articles. How do I make the first letter of a string uppercase in JavaScript? We use cookies to ensure that we give you the best experience on our website. An adverb which means "doing without understanding". How does carriage return line feed ( CRLF ) injection attack work? You also have the option to opt-out of these cookies. On a typewriter, it meant literally causing the carriage holding the paper to return to the left margin so you could start a new line. The code is \n . A carriage return in C programming language is a special code that helps to move the cursor/print head to the beginning of the current line. What is the value of . When Text data initial with "|" on Barcode 128A, it was removed in Barcode. so it matches every character (instead of every character except ). function square(x) { return x * x; } const demo = square(3); // demo will equal 9. In ES6 with string templates you just introduce the carriage return as written text. 2. process.stdout.write('long message first') process.stdout.write('short message') This prints messages one after another on the same line. A line feed means moving one line forward. QGIS: Aligning elements in the second column in the legend, Write a Program Detab That Replaces Tabs in the Input with the Proper Number of Blanks to Space to the Next Tab Stop, Poisson regression with constraint on the coefficients of two variables be the same, what's the difference between "the killing machine" and "the machine that's killing", How Could One Calculate the Crit Chance in 13th Age for a Monk with Ki in Anydice? How to store objects in HTML5 localStorage/sessionStorage. Definition and Usage. Please have a look over the code example and the steps given below. the end of a field value: str = str + '\n'; but this writting does not work, because the Javascript produced in the. We also use third-party cookies that help us analyze and understand how you use this website. The carriage return character is called so because its a new line character, and in a typewriter, to go to a new line the carriage is moved (returned) to the beginning of the line. In SQL Server, we can use the CHAR function with ASCII number code. Find centralized, trusted content and collaborate around the technologies you use most. The c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. Sorted by: 5. The HTML element produces a line break in text (carriage-return). In javascript, Line Feed and Carriage Return behaves similarly. A newline character would simple shift the roller to the next line without moving the print head. What is a light-weight "slideshow" script that could integrate w/ CMS? For a complete String reference, go to our: The reference contains descriptions and examples of all string properties and methods. How does one go about creating an equivalent function in SQL like LTRIM or RTRIM for carriage returns and line feeds ONLY at the start or end of a string. This cookie is set by GDPR Cookie Consent plugin. A carriage return means moving the cursor to the beginning of the line. 1. The cookie is used to store the user consent for the cookies in the category "Analytics". Windows uses \r\n to signify the enter key was pressed, while Linux and Unix use \n to signify that the enter key was pressed. Copyright 2023 ITQAGuru.com | All rights reserved. Find And Replace With A Newline In Visual Studio Code. How do I return the response from an asynchronous call? In this tutorial, you will learn how to replace a character with carriage return in javascript. @AKTed could you explain why i should prefer newline (\n) more than line feed (\r) ?

Are Jared And Ashley Still Together, Which Tool Enables The Deployment Of Integrated Quality Management System, Montgomery High School Nj Student Dies, Atlantis Booking Bahamas, Philippe Jaroussky Husband, Articles W

what is carriage return in javascript

Scroll to top